SpringBoot @Value 注解使用 当我想读取 application.yml/application.properties配置文件的参数值时,接触到了@Value注解。 部分知识参考:https://blog.csdn.net/woheniccc/article/details ...
代码中的用法 Spring 通过 Value注解获取 .porperties文件code的内容,然后赋值给使用该注解的Code属性上。 看一下这个resource.properties文件 resource为文件名称 spring中的配置 该文件的引入有三中实现方式,如上提供最简单,最常用的一种方式提供参考。 ...
2018-04-07 18:51 0 2314 推荐指数:
SpringBoot @Value 注解使用 当我想读取 application.yml/application.properties配置文件的参数值时,接触到了@Value注解。 部分知识参考:https://blog.csdn.net/woheniccc/article/details ...
1,通过@value来注入对应的值,直接在字段上添加@value 获取application.properties文件中的值。 View Code 2,通过配置@ConfigurationProperties(prefix="jdbc") ,通过前缀去找 ...
大家都知道@Value注解是从spring的配置文件里读取配置并给指定属性赋值 在这里给大家介绍两个实际开发中可能会用到的场景: 1. @Value注解添加默认值 如上所示, 如不能正确读取到配置文件的 max.num 属性, 则maxNum会赋予默认值3 2. ...
老是忘记,就做个记录 @Value @Value不能和 static 和 final 搭配使用 类没有加上@Component(或者@service等) 类被new新建了实例,而没有使用@Autowired @PostConstruct 这个不是spring ...
为了简化读取properties文件中的配置值,spring支持@value注解的方式来获取,这种方式大大简化了项目配置,提高业务中的灵活性。 1. 两种使用方法1)@Value("#{configProperties['key']}")2)@Value("${key}") 2. 配置文件示例 ...
当使用@Value注解获取配置文件中的值注入到非静态变量中时,只需要将@Value("${}")放到响应的变量上方即可。当非静态变量变为静态变量时,处理方式有所不同。 配置文件 注入到非静态变量 注入到静态变量 至于为什么不直接在静态方法中使用非 ...
1.@Value注解作用 该注解的作用是将我们配置文件的属性读出来,有@Value(“${}”)和@Value(“#{}”)两种方式。 2.@Value注解作用的两种方式 场景 假如有以下属性文件dev.properties, 需要注入下面的tager 第一种方式@Value ...
首先我报这个错误的原因是:idea没有识别出来application.properties是配置文件,因为没有叶子图标。解决办法很简单: 1.右键你的resources文件夹 2.选择“Mark Directory as” 3.再选择Resources Root ...